Further Extension

The Company has submitted an application to SGX RegCo for a further extension of two (2) months to convene the FY2019 AGM by 28 February 2021 with regard to compliance with Rule 707(1) of the Listing Manual (the "Further Extension").

Reasons for the Further Extension

The Report recommended that the Company's auditors, Ernst & Young LLP ("EY") consider the implications of certain matters, including whether any reclassification or adjustments are necessary to the financial statements for FY2019 to ensure that the Company's records represent a complete and accurate view of its financial affairs.

Since the Report was issued, the Company has worked closely with EY and its legal advisors to address the matters raised in the Report, as well as the areas of concern identified in the Regulatory Announcement. The need for EY to validate the Independent Accountant's findings in the Report with respect to FY2018 and prior years and to design and perform additional procedures for the FY2019 audit have led to the delay in completion of the FY2019 audit. As at the date of this announcement, certain audit procedures in relation to the Group's

1

China operations remain outstanding and EY anticipates that all audit procedures will be completed around early February 2021. Factoring in discussions with the Audit Committee of the Company and management to complete the FY2019 audit, it is expected that the audited financial statements will only be finalised and the FY2019 AGM documents will be issued to Shareholders around mid-February 2021. Accordingly, the earliest date that the Company will be able to convene the FY2019 AGM is at the end of February 2021.

The Company will continue to devote the full extent of its resources to assist EY to assess the accounting matters in the Report and complete the FY2019 audit as soon as possible.
